Buffer System Explained
TPT buffer example (50K account):
- Starting balance: $50,000
- Max drawdown: $2,000
- Buffer threshold: $52,000
- Once you hit $52,000, every dollar above is withdrawable immediately
Real scenario: Make $3,000 in 5 days → balance $53,000 → withdraw $1,000 (80% = $800) → money in your bank next day
YRM equivalent: Make $3,000 in 5 days → still need 5 more profitable days → wait for payout cycle → money arrives 20-25 days later

Live vs Sim Capital Difference
Alpha Futures (Live):
- Real broker execution
- Real slippage/fills
- Real market impact
- Counts toward FINRA reporting
YRM Prop (Sim initially):
- Simulated execution
- Simulated fills
- No market impact
- Doesn't count as real trading
Why it matters: Professional traders building track records need live capital. Sim trading doesn't translate to actual trading experience for career progression.
